(Hardy Aster) In late summer, Aster 'Blue Autumn' PPAF is covered with hundreds of daisy-like deep blue flowers that put on a spectacular show through fall. The healthy dark green foliage of 'Blue Autumn' PPAF has a compact mounding habit and is very resistant to mildew. Also attracts butterflies!

Homeowner Growing & Maintenance Tips:
Asters perform best in rich, well-drained soils. Proper spacing is essential because Asters tend to meld down from August heat and humidity if there is not good air circulation around the base of the plant. Good air circulation will also help to prevent powdery mildew. Asters do need to be mulched during the winter months. Pinch back in early summer to promote branching, short growth and more flowers. Asters also need to be divided every other spring to maintain their health and vigor. Propagation is by stem cuttings or division.
